Where does “synnyttimet” come from?

synnyttimet (Finnish) comes from Finnish synnyttää, from Proto-Finnic sündüttädäk, from Proto-Finnic süntüdäk, from Proto-Uralic *sentew- — to be born.

synnyttimet (Finnish): female reproductive organs collectively
